Berkshire Hathaway Chairman Warren Buffett has been a legendary figure in investment circles for over half a century, and his stock picks are keenly watched by both experienced and rookie players.
However, the “Oracle of Omaha” has remained steadfast in his opposition to cryptocurrencies and related investments, even though some of them may have outperformed the hottest equities in his portfolio.
What happened: In terms of market value, Apple Inc. (NASDAQ:AAPL) was Berkshire Hathaway’s biggest holding, with a stake worth nearly $70 billion at the end of September, according to an SEC filing.
